As Microsoft ends support for Windows 10 in October 2025, businesses must take decisive action to prepare for Windows 11. Whether you’re a small business or a growing enterprise, this transition isn’t just about a new interface—it’s about cybersecurity, performance, compliance, and long-term scalability.
This guide provides a comprehensive Windows 11 migration checklist, including what the upgrade means, why it’s essential, how to plan, and what small to mid-sized businesses (SMBs) must do now to stay ahead.
What Happens When Windows 10 Support Ends?
Microsoft’s lifecycle policy grants operating systems a fixed support window. With Windows 10 nearing end-of-life, the consequences go far beyond missing feature updates:
- No more security patches, leaving systems vulnerable to cyberattacks.
- Compliance risks for industries governed by regulations such as HIPAA, PCI-DSS, or CMMC.
- Compatibility issues with newer applications, cloud services, and hardware.
- Increased IT costs due to reactive maintenance and downtime.
Without timely migration, SMBs expose themselves to the very threats cybersecurity solutions are designed to mitigate.
Why Migrating to Windows 11 Matters for Business Continuity
Windows 11 is more than a facelift—it offers advanced features designed to support the modern workplace:
- Enhanced endpoint security, crucial in hybrid and remote setups.
- Optimized performance with support for modern CPUs and SSDs.
- Deeper integration with Microsoft 365 and Teams.
- Streamlined UI to boost user efficiency.
For businesses using cloud-based productivity tools like Microsoft 365, Windows 11 enhances the experience while reducing friction across devices.
Assessing Your Current Environment
Before upgrading, audit your IT infrastructure. Use this checklist:
- Inventory all Windows devices and OS versions.
- Check hardware compatibility with Windows 11 (TPM 2.0, UEFI, Secure Boot, minimum system requirements).
- Identify mission-critical software and ensure compatibility.
- Determine staff readiness and potential training needs.
Businesses already struggling with IT challenges should lean on professional audits to reduce risk during migration.
Key Migration Checklist for Windows 11
Use this phased approach for a smoother upgrade:
1. Assess and Plan
- Use Microsoft’s PC Health Check Tool.
- Consult IT experts to create a migration roadmap.
- Align the plan with quarterly goals or fiscal year cycles.
2. Backup Everything
- Conduct a full data backup of all devices.
- Test recovery processes to validate backup integrity.
3. Update and Replace
- Upgrade hardware as needed.
- Update firmware, BIOS, and device drivers.
4. Test Applications and Workflows
- Create a test environment.
- Run key software tools in Windows 11.
- Document performance changes or issues.
5. Train Employees
- Share knowledge on new features and layouts.
- Offer training sessions to reduce productivity loss.
6. Deploy in Phases
- Start with IT and management teams.
- Monitor systems, then expand to all users.
Common Pitfalls and How to Avoid Them
Businesses often underestimate:
- The cost of downtime if migration disrupts workflows.
- The need for cybersecurity updates during the upgrade window.
- The human element—employee readiness is key to adoption.
Avoid delays and mistakes by proactively adopting managed IT services that include transition support.
Strengthening Security with Windows 11
Windows 11 features are built for today’s threat landscape:
- Microsoft Pluton Security Processor
- Virtualization-based security (VBS)
- Hardware-enforced stack protection
- Secure Boot and BitLocker integration
Pairing these with email security and endpoint detection systems amplifies protection against phishing, ransomware, and insider threats.
Cloud and Hybrid Work Readiness
Windows 11 is optimized for the hybrid world. For businesses embracing cloud services, migration unlocks:
- Seamless access to OneDrive, SharePoint, and Teams.
- Built-in productivity analytics.
- Tighter security integration for remote access.
The OS complements trends in hybrid collaboration tools, allowing smoother workflows across in-office and remote teams.
Why SMBs Need Managed IT Services for Migration
For small and mid-sized businesses, upgrading alone isn’t enough. A managed IT services provider can:
- Conduct readiness assessments.
- Create custom upgrade plans.
- Provide 24/7 monitoring and support.
- Manage licenses, security patches, and compliance needs.
Partnering with the right MSP helps SMBs shift from reactive to proactive IT—reducing costs, enhancing business resilience, and ensuring future scalability.
What If You Don’t Upgrade?
Post-2025, staying on Windows 10 leaves you exposed. Here’s what to expect:
- Compliance fines if your systems fail audits.
- Increased cyber threats targeting unpatched machines.
- Vendor incompatibility, forcing late-stage, costly upgrades.
- Downtime as support teams struggle to patch broken tools.
This scenario mirrors the fallout from businesses that ignored the end of Windows 7. Don’t repeat history.
Choosing the Right Time to Upgrade
Start now. Planning months in advance ensures you have:
- Enough time for staff training.
- Flexibility in budgeting and procurement.
- Contingency room for app testing and hardware delays.
If you’re already facing downtime, upgrades may even provide immediate cost savings.
Don’t Forget Compliance Requirements
Highly regulated industries like healthcare, finance, and legal face strict technology mandates. Upgrading to Windows 11 supports compliance standards such as:
- GDPR
- HIPAA
- SOX
- PCI-DSS
Failing to meet these due to an outdated OS may result in steep penalties.
Conclusion
Windows 11 isn’t just the future—it’s your business’s gateway to productivity, security, and compliance. Waiting until the last minute only increases costs and operational risk.
If your team lacks the resources for seamless transition, IT support from experienced professionals ensures a smoother path forward.
Don’t wait for Windows 10 to reach its end-of-life. Start your migration planning today—and make Windows 11 an asset, not a burden.

